Transaction 2ccc57c4fe5b7f5d2250f08a59828ecc607c4dc00001be3c45a12379499c6ac6
1 Input
1 Output
-
2ccc57c4fe5b7f5d2250f08a59828ecc607c4dc00001be3c45a12379499c6ac6:0
- value
- 23425462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0818565f8153a9deea1c470a3cdfcbb8d582bd5 OP_EQUAL
- address
- 3LhVdj9BPyta3MLVbQemNc9v1rDw833j5A